The tt⎯ production cross section (σtt⎯) is measured in proton-proton collisions at √s=7 TeV in data collected by the CMS experiment, corresponding to an integrated luminosity of 2.3 fb−1. The measurement is performed in events with two leptons (electrons or muons) in the final state, at least two jets identified as jets originating from b quarks, and the presence of an imbalance in transverse momentum. The measured value of σtt⎯ for a top-quark mass of 172.5 GeV is 161.9±2.5(stat.)+5.1−5.0(syst.)±3.6(lumi.)pb , consistent with the prediction of the standard model
